What is the appropriate dosing for albuterol via nebulization in adults?

Explanation:
The appropriate dosing for albuterol via nebulization in adults typically consists of 2.5 mg of albuterol mixed with 2.5 mL of saline. This dosage is commonly used in clinical practice for the treatment of bronchospasm associated with conditions such as asthma or chronic obstructive pulmonary disease (COPD). Albuterol is a bronchodilator that acts quickly to relax muscles in the airways and increase airflow to the lungs. The 2.5 mg dose is considered effective for managing acute respiratory distress, and combining it with 2.5 mL of saline helps to create the appropriate volume for nebulization. This mixture ensures optimal delivery of the medication as a mist that can be inhaled deeply into the lungs. In clinical settings, this dosing guideline is widely accepted and is supported by current emergency medicine protocols and pharmacological references, making it an essential point for EMTs to know when administering treatment to adult patients experiencing respiratory issues.

What does that 2.5 mg/2.5 mL look like in real life?

Let me explain it in plain terms. Albuterol is a bronchodilator — it relaxes the smooth muscles around the airways, opening the passage so air can flow more freely. The nebulizer turns that medicine into a mist small enough to be inhaled deeply into the lungs. The 2.5 mg dose, paired with 2.5 mL of saline, provides enough medication to reach the lower airways without flooding the system and without diluting the dose so much that it loses potency. It strikes a balance between efficacy and safety, which is exactly what you want in the back of an ambulance or a busy ER hallway.

This is the dose you’ll see reflected in many emergency medicine protocols and standard reference texts. It’s the workhorse for adults with bronchospasm associated with asthma or COPD. You’ll see variations in the field, especially with different device types or patient needs, but the 2.5/2.5 combo remains the anchor for adults who aren’t in the middle of extreme tachycardia or other complicating factors.

Who benefits most from this dosing approach

  • Adults with acute bronchospasm due to asthma or COPD

  • Patients presenting with wheeze, shortness of breath, or chest tightness where rapid bronchodilation is desired

  • Those who can tolerate a nebulizer setup and don’t have contraindications for beta-agonists

That said, it’s not a one-size-fits-all mantra. In the field, you assess how the patient responds to the initial dose. If there’s little to no improvement after 5 to 15 minutes and the patient’s condition allows, you may consider additional therapy as per your protocols. But the 2.5 mg/2.5 mL combination is the starting point you should recognize and feel confident applying.

A practical, step-by-step sense of how this plays out in the moment

  • Confirm the order and ensure you’re using a standard nebulizer with current saline.

  • Prepare 2.5 mL of saline and 2.5 mg of albuterol. If you’re using stock vials, mix them according to your department’s guidelines to get that precise 2.5 mg dose in 2.5 mL saline.

  • Attach the mouthpiece or mask, and ensure the patient is seated comfortably with good head and neck alignment to maximize inhalation depth.

  • Instruct the patient to breathe normally, then slowly take a deep breath, holding briefly at the end of inhalation if the device allows. The goal is to maximize alveolar deposition rather than quick, shallow breaths.

  • Monitor vital signs closely — heart rate, blood pressure, respiratory rate, oxygen saturation — during the treatment.

  • Reassess after the first dosing window. If you’re seeing improved air movement and the patient reports relief, you can continue with the plan. If not, follow your protocols for escalation or additional dosing, always with patient safety at the forefront.

Safety first: what to watch for

Albuterol is generally well tolerated, but it’s not without potential side effects. In adults, you might notice:

  • Tremors or shakiness, especially in the hands

  • Increased heart rate or palpitations

  • Nervousness or jitteriness

  • Mild headache or dizziness

In most cases, these are transient and manageable, but if they’re severe or persistent, you adjust the care plan and document carefully. You’ll also want to be mindful of conditions that can complicate bronchodilator therapy:

  • People with significant tachycardia or certain heart rhythm issues

  • Those with high blood pressure where sympathetic stimulation could be risky

  • Patients with known sensitivity or allergy to albuterol or other components

Keep in mind: this dosing is for adults. Pediatric dosing, weight-based calculations, or alternate dilutions exist, and you’ll follow those precise guidelines when the patient isn’t an adult.

Common missteps you’ll want to sidestep

  • Using the wrong diluent volume or an incorrect albuterol concentration. The standard is 2.5 mg in 2.5 mL saline for adults, and sticking to that helps keep outcomes predictable.

  • Skipping the reassessment after the first dose. A quick check-in on vitals and respiratory status tells you whether to proceed, modify, or call for higher-level care.

  • Improper nebulizer technique. A poor seal with a mask or a rushed breath pattern can lead to suboptimal deposition of the mist.

  • Not monitoring for side effects or over-reliance on a single symptom. You want objective signs (lung sounds, oxygenation, work of breathing) to track improvement, not just the patient’s subjective sense of relief.

Real-world tips that make the difference

  • If the patient has a mouthpiece and can tolerate it, a tight seal helps some of the mist reach the deeper airways more effectively than a loose fit.

  • A spacer isn’t typically used with a nebulizer in the same way it is with metered-dose inhalers, but follow your department’s equipment guidelines. Some teams prefer masks for kids or anxious adults to reduce coughing fits and improve comfort.

  • Keep the environment calm and explain what you’re doing as you go. Clear communication makes a big difference in how well a patient tolerates a nebulizer session.

  • Document not just the dose, but timing, the patient’s response, and any side effects. This isn’t just paperwork—it's essential for continuing care if the patient needs transport or escalation.
